Actually the $70 an hour is a combination of hourly pay and benefits. The average UAW hourly wage is $28 and the average non-UAW is $25 an hour but the UAW gets about $45 in benefits per hour while the non-UAW is about half that (using round figures) which is where the $70 comes from, average non-UAW total is about $50.
